Device and method for trigger point massage therapy
A trigger point massage therapy device for well-controlled trigger point therapy, suitable for long-term use by a health practitioner with minimal risk of pain or injury, can include a main body with a handle, rubberized grips, a connection pin, that can connect to a pressure point base with a pressure point tip, whereon can further be installed additional pressure point tips in different sizes; a pressure sensor, a step-vibration component, an electro-motor; and additionally heating, ultra sound, electrical stimulation, infrared, and cold laser light components. The device can further include a control unit, which can be used for programming and controlling the functions of the device. Also described is a method for trigger point massage therapy, including measuring a pressure, adjusting the pressure, holding the pressure, rotating/unwinding, vibrating, and increasing the pressure.
COMPRESSION GARMENT
In an embodiment, a compression garment can include one or more of a flex frame, a shape memory material, a backing, and a control module. In some variations, the flex frame can include a set of support regions, a set of cutout regions, a set of bridges, one or more terminals, and one or more rotation points. In some variations, the compression garment 100 can further include a fabric sleeve, one or more fasteners, a power module, and/or any other suitable component. The compression garment functions as a compression device (e.g., to improve circulation, enhance muscle recovery, etc.), and can additionally or alternatively function as a passive compression device, a heating and/or cooling device, or perform any other suitable functionality.
ADJUSTABLE BED FOUNDATIONS AND RELATED METHODS
An adjustable bed foundation includes an adjustable frame and at least one height adjuster configured to raise and lower a portion of the adjustable frame. The adjustable frame defines a support surface, a bottom surface opposite the support surface, and a plurality of lateral side surfaces intersecting each of the support surface and the bottom surface. A fabric at least partially covers the plurality of lateral side surfaces and is secured to a material covering the support surface. A massage device is disposed within the adjustable frame and configured to impart vibration to a mattress disposed on the adjustable frame. The massage device is secured to the adjustable frame by a flexible fastener, and a gap between the flexible fastener and the support surface is between about 2 mm and about 10 mm. Related methods are also disclosed.
SKIN CLEANSER
A skin cleanser includes a surface, such as a silicone surface, with at least one textured portion for transmitting vibrational tapping to the skin. The skin cleanser includes at least one oscillating motor for generating the tapping motion to the skin. The textured portion includes touch-points or a wave that transmit the tapping motion to skin in contact with the textured portions. The touch-points may include thicker and thinner formations of the touch-points to provide firmer or softer vibrations to the skin. The touch-points are within about 0.5 to 2.5 mm in diameter. One configuration includes multiple oscillating motors configured to provide different vibration frequencies at around 50-300 Hertz and operable simultaneously.

DEVICES, SYSTEMS AND METHODS FOR PAIN MANAGEMENT AND BONE HEALING
Systems and methods disclosed herein provide efficacious therapies based on delivery of combinations of thermoceuticals, electroceuticals, ultrasound via computer-implemented systems. Sensors coupled to the device are configured to measure changes in tissue and bone conditions, physiological data resulting from the delivered therapy. The personalized therapy can be adjusted based on the changes in the physiological or sensor data and/or patient feedback. The patient information, information about the applied therapy, and therapy outcome information can be added to the analytics database.

Method and system for regulating core body temperature
A method for maintaining and/or increasing body temperature of a patient may involve delivering heat to a first location on a limb of the patient, delivering heat to a second location on the limb, apart from the first location, and applying intermittent compression to a third location on the limb, located between the first location and the second location. A device for maintaining and/or increasing body temperature of a patient may include a sleeve for positioning over at least part of one of the patient's limbs, first and second heat delivery members coupled with the sleeve, and an intermittent compression member coupled with the sleeve between the first and second heat delivery members.
At-home light-emitting diode and massage device for vaginal rejuvenation
A light emitting module and massage device provide vaginal rejuvenation. The device exposes collagen in the vaginal area or mucosa to temperatures elevated over normal body temperature to cause the collagen to reversibly or irreversibly denature while simultaneously applying vibration. Once thermally-induced collagen denaturation has occurred, both neoelastogenesis and neocollagenesis may occur and may be initiated with fibroblast proliferation, which may be promoted with vibration. Neofibrogenesis also occurs due to the fibroblastic activity, responsible for secretion of new collagen matrix to effect tissue repair. Thus, the device exploits thermally-induced collagen denaturation and repair along with simultaneous vibration to improve tissue tone, connective tissue tension and bulk tissue regeneration.
Aromatherapy apparatus and housing
The present invention is an apparatus for employing aromatherapy and binaural sounds for inducing a state of relaxation in a user who may be anxious, upset, or experiencing sleeping difficulties. The apparatus comprises a shape memory foam pillow, a pair of stereo speakers, an aromatherapy diffuser, a pillowcase comprised of heat-transfer fabric, an optional vibrating device, a canopy and a housing to support these elements. The user connects a smartphone or digital audio device to the speakers, activates the aromatherapy diffuser and the vibrating device, and lays his or her head down on the pillow beneath the canopy. Ideally, the smartphone or music device should have a meditation or binaural sound application, which would be tuned to a specific beat frequency, such as 10 Hertz. The combined action of essential oil vapors and binaural sounds should enable the user to relax or sleep more soundly.
